This middle-grade fiction book offers a thoughtful exploration of emotions during adolescence, helping young readers understand and navigate their feelings and relationships. Suitable for ages 9 to 12, it gently addresses the complexities of growing up without heavy content concerns, making it a supportive resource for emotional development.

Why we rated You and your feelings 9LE

You and your feelings is written at a Level 4-5 reading level across 117 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 5.5 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, You and your feelings works for readers up to grade 6.5.

We rate You and your feelings as 9LE ("Light — Emotional") because the content sits in the "Mild" range — mild conflict — the kind a child encounters in normal play and sibling life.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ly mild; no single dimension stands out as a concern.

No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the mild intensity score.

Thematically, You and your feelings explores emotions, adolescence, friendship, and coming of age —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
